Question
Express the following ratios in its simplest form :
2.5 : 5
Advertisements
Solution
`2.5:5=25/10:5/1=25/10div5/1=25/10xx1/5=5/10=1:2`
OR `2.5:5=2.5:5.0=2.5/5.0=25/50=1/2=1:2`
